How to Say ‘It was in front’ in Italian

Era davanti

EH-rah dah-VAHN-tee

[EH-rah dah-VAHN-tee]

💬 Usage Tip: [davanti] often needs [a] before a place: [davanti alla stazione], [davanti al bar]. On its own, [era davanti] is fine when the place is already clear from context.

Phrase Breakdown

Era

[EH-rah]

it was

Imperfect form of essere; here it means something was or used to be in a place.

Example

Era davanti al bar, non davanti alla stazione.

It was in front of the bar, not in front of the station.

davanti

[dah-VAHN-tee]

in front

An adverb or preposition meaning in front or ahead.

Example

Il taxi era davanti all'ingresso principale.

The taxi was in front of the main entrance.
